Safety Philosophy
IDI Fly Dashboard follows a layered safety model: configurable thresholds trigger automatic protective actions before situations become emergencies, and manual overrides remain available to the pilot at all times. Always verify failsafe settings before each operational deployment.
Familiarise yourself with the E-Stop procedure and AVSS status before every flight. In an emergency, a clear understanding of these controls is critical.
